Repeating my 6/1 post in the May thread:
Leanna I am the one who called it a bait n switch at WAG. I just KNOW better and will walk out w/o buying anything if I cannot do the entire deal I want. I do NOT need WAG. I have CVS, Walmart, Target, Safeway, Albersons and a BUNCH of independent stores. WAG NEEDS me & my few $$. The WAG foil deal was ONLY for Sun & Mon. Walmart will prob NOT honor it now.
When it comes to EC (I, as a single person seldom buy more than 1-2 of any single item) I think we will see a drop off when they realize the do NOT get $200-300 worth of stuff for $2.95. Hey-here the sales tax is more than that (can run $4.50-$30). They will decide the time planning, effort of clipping and multiple store shopping is not worth it to them. They do NOT realize couponing is like dieting-slow & steady wins the game. Living in a major urban area I can plan routine routes that take me past all store I want. We can only hope the stores do not change policies too much in response to EC.
